DC Bilingual Public Charter School

DC Bilingual PCS is a spanish-english bilingual school serving DC students in PreK-5th grade. We have a spacious outdoor classroom with an herb garden, an edible garden and cooking space, butterfly and pollinator gardens, and more. Our garden is a rich educational space that supports learning in all subject areas in addition to being an important green, growing haven for our urban students and families.

The Charlie Cart Project

The Charlie Cart Project is an integrated educational program that connects food and cooking with lessons in Math, English Language Arts, Science and Social Studies. We combine a rigorous curriculum with a mobile kitchen classroom to deliver hands-on nutrition education in any learning environment.

Mountain View High School Culinary Arts

Once a week our program runs the Wildcat Cafe. We open up the Cafe to the teachers and administration and serve them lunch in either sit down or carryout fashion. Once each year, our program also hosts a Teacher of the Year banquet and a Service Employee of the Year banquet. We also cater for teachers not only at the school, but to the entire Stafford County School District. We have also filled out orders from student run events, like Princess Boot Camp.
